I am on my 20 DPO , urine HCG test came positive. I was taking normoz and fol xt every morning, Bevon multivitamin every night.
What to do now onwards for further confirmation or sustenance. Do's and don'ts please guide, I am working woman. Thanks,

Continue Fol CT and Normoz Tablet
Mothers Horlicks two spoons with milk two times a day for a month
Avoid lifting weights and stress and intercourses and travel
Take a boiled egg daily
Drink lots of water and fruits juice
Sleep for two hours in afternoon and for eight hours at bedtime with left lateral position to improve blood flow to baby
Next Steps
Get ultrasound pelvis done for uterus tubes and ovaries and gestational sac at 7 weeks of pregnancy to confirm the date and location of pregnancy
Health Tips
Get Complete Blood count, blood group, urine routine analysis, HIV , HbS , blood sugar fasting and postprandial and thyroid test done empty stomach tomorrow morning

Hi. You can continue all the medicines as before except the multivit tab till 7 weeks . Folxt is enough Do a Obstetric scan for fetal heart at 7 wks .have normal diet . No sexual contact . No fruits like Papaya and Pineapple . Avoid oily , spicy and food from outside .
